JAGS BACK TO CONFERENCE PLAY FRIDAY HOSTING SOUTHERN UTAH

IUPUI and Southern Utah begin three-game set on Friday with doubleheader against Thunderbirds

4/5/2012 11:06:00 AM

INDIANAPOLIS – The IUPUI softball team returns home on Friday, April 6, to open a three-game Summit League set against Southern Utah at the IUPUI Softball Complex with a doubleheader beginning at 4 p.m.

The Jags are coming off a 9-1 loss to in-state foe Purdue on Tuesday, which dropped their record to 10-23 on the season. IUPUI had a weekend away from Summit League competition last weekend and come into action against the Thunderbirds with a 2-7 conference mark.

Despite two mid-week losses to BYU, Southern Utah makes the cross country-trip to Indianapolis with a 20-15 overall record and an 8-4 conference record after taking two of three from UMKC last weekend in Cedar City, Utah.

Over the past 10 games, the Jags have struggled as a team offensively hitting just .215, but their pitching staff has held their opponents to just a .216 average. Despite the offensive struggles, Nicole Checkie has been a bright spot at the plate hitting .394 (13-of-33) since March 20.

Aundria Basquez and Kelsey Rupert are the only other players hitting over .270 during this stretch hitting .294 and .273, respectively.

In the circle, Jocelyn Oppenhuis has been a steady performer on the mound posting a 2.10 ERA in six starts since the latter third of March. Since that point, Oppenhuis has made five starts and she went the distance in three of those outings.

Oppenhuis and the rest of the pitching staff will have to be on their game when the Thunderbirds come to town as they are one of the top hitting teams in the conference collectively hitting .321. SUU has two players hitting over .400 in Mikkel Griffin (.435) and Terysa Dyer (.411), and Griffin also leads the squad with eight home runs. Five players have already driven in more than 20 runs this season.

As a pitching staff, Southern Utah owns an ERA of 3.57 and Heather Black is the ace of the staff owning a 2.66 ERA in 131.1 innings of work.
